Platform Risk

Pronunciation: PLAT-fawrm RISK

Definition

Platform risk is exposure created by dependence on a shared technology, marketplace, operating system, cloud, protocol, or service ecosystem. Overview

Platform risk arises when business activity depends on rules, infrastructure, interfaces, distribution, data, or users controlled by another platform. Changes can affect access, pricing, visibility, compatibility, compliance, security, or continuity.

Concentration may be hidden when several products rely on the same cloud, app store, identity provider, blockchain, payment rail, or software base. Governance decisions, outages, account suspension, protocol changes, and ecosystem attacks can create broad impact.

Organizations should map dependencies, monitor changes, negotiate rights where possible, maintain portable data and credentials, diversify critical paths, and test exit. Contingency plans must account for technical migration, customer communication, settlement, and legal obligations. Decision-makers should quantify switching time, cost, data loss, and operational disruption.
